The Core Architecture Breakdown OpenGradient implements a robust three-layer technical defense to protect user queries: Local Encryption: Your messages are secured directly on your device before they ever hit the web. Oblivious HTTP (OHTTP) Relays: This layer completely decouples user identity from the message content. The relay sees your IP address but only passes along ciphertext; the downstream gateway reads the plaintext prompt but has absolutely no window into who sent it. TEE-Isolated Gateways: Prompts are decrypted exclusively inside a Trusted Execution Environment (TEE) featuring remote attestation. Memory is completely sealed, guaranteeing that not even the infrastructure operator can read or log your history.
